Transaction 89c51d9bf137a4a3b3aae26f6a8eb793f8cc490b8f032b9b77568c2fa07c5fee
1 Input
1 Output
-
89c51d9bf137a4a3b3aae26f6a8eb793f8cc490b8f032b9b77568c2fa07c5fee:0
- value
- 138905
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 342de2c4e76a39337a3d9a77c1f17f0d4af6d308 OP_EQUALVERIFY OP_CHECKSIG
- address
- 15ku7BJau8JdpoZCWkCpygtv7J1kSMFfvF